MONTREAL, Sept. 7, 2021 /CNW Telbec/ - Air Canada today
unveiled its expanded Travel Ready hub, an interactive online tool
to help customers plan and prepare for upcoming trips. Customers
can use it to easily and conveniently obtain such information as
necessary travel documentation, COVID-19 test requirements and
country travel restrictions for any global destination. Air
Canada's Travel Ready hub is available at
aircanada.com/travelready and on the mobile version of the Air
Canada website.

The airline's enhanced Travel Ready hub features a search widget
so that users can access information specific to their situation
and itinerary. Among other things: the hub allows customers to
review entry requirements for every country on their itinerary,
including if they are connecting via another country or traveling
with an Air Canada airline partner; if their travels require a
COVID-19 test, ensure they have the right test (molecular or
antigen) taken within the valid time window; and provide travel
advice, particularly related to airport arrival times, given
additional checks in-place. All of these features are designed with
the goal of delivering a smoother and quicker airport experience
for customers.
Air Canada will continue
implementing initiatives to streamline the travel process, increase
customer convenience via digital tools, and remain a leader in
adopting science-based measures to further enhance safety. To date,
the airline has put in place the following measures for customers
to travel easily, confidently and safely:
- Ongoing restoration and strategic rebuilding of its
international, transborder and domestic network to conveniently
reunite people with friends and family, together with flexible and
expanded change and cancellation options for bookings;
- A new digital solution via the Air Canada App and website,
enabling customers flying between Canada and select countries to conveniently
and securely scan and upload COVID-19 test results to validate
compliance with government travel requirements prior to arriving at
the airport;
- Numerous streamlined processes, from several check-in options
via web, mobile or airport self-serve kiosk, Touch-Free Bag Check
and Bag Drop services, digital presentation of all reading
materials via PressReader on personal devices. In the lounge, meals
can be ordered and delivered straight to the table through the new
Maple Leaf Lounge @ la table service, with additional opportunities
to further modernize processes underway;
- The award-winning Air Canada CleanCare+ program, featuring
enhanced biosafety measures throughout every stage of air travel
from check-in to lounges to boarding to on-board, which includes
highly efficient HEPA air filters on aircraft;
- As of Oct. 31, 2021, Air Canada
is requiring all its employees to be fully vaccinated against
COVID-19, further ensuring the safety and well-being of customers
and employees.
About Air Canada
Air Canada is Canada's largest domestic and
international airline and, in 2019, was among the top 20 largest
airlines in the world. It is Canada's flag carrier and a
founding member of Star Alliance, the world's most
comprehensive air transportation network. Air Canada is
the only international network carrier in North
America to receive a Four-Star ranking according to
independent U.K. research firm Skytrax. In 2020, Air Canada was
named Global Traveler's Best Airline in North America for
the second straight year. In January 2021, Air Canada received
APEX's Diamond Status Certification for the Air Canada CleanCare+
biosafety program for managing COVID-19, the only airline
in Canada to attain the highest APEX ranking.
Air Canada has also committed to a net zero emissions
goal from all global operations by 2050. For more information,
